Neuroticism--the tendency to experience negative emotions, along with the perception that the world is filled with unmanageable challenges--is strongly associated with anxiety, depression, and other common mental health conditions. This groundbreaking volume shows how targeting this trait in psychotherapy can benefit a broad range of clients.
